    On the 2wd I've seen conflicting info from parts houses.

    '84-94
    '84-87 then '88-94


    Any clarification would be appreciated.

    I'm wanting to know as I'm planning o. A frame swap and want/need to know if parts are interchangeable. Looking at getting lower drop control arms, but won't do so unless I know they are interchangeable. My understanding was '84-94 were same design until they went to the taco.     84-87 and 88-up have different front end components. I can't remember exactly, but its not the same. Spindles are, but lca and strut rods I think are not the same

    I'm finding conflicting data on the LCAs also. I've seen a lot of stock replacements out there listed as 84-88. I'm mainly interested in the after market ones. DJM has lower control arms with 3" drop. They state they fit 88 and up. Streetacos has them as part of a lowering kit for 84-95.

    Does anyone know for sure when or if the LCA changed between 84 and 95 and if the DJM would fit an 85?
